Referring to fig. 1-3, an energy-saving and environment-friendly garden irrigation device comprises a base 1, a water storage tank 2 is welded on the upper end surface of the base 1, one end of the base 1 is fixedly connected with a push handle 3, the lower end surface of the base 1 is welded with four support frames 6, the lower ends of the two support frames 6 close to the push handle 3 are rotatably connected with a same worm 8 through bearings, two rear wheels 701 are coaxially welded on the two ends of the worm 8, the lower ends of the two support frames 6 far away from the push handle 3 are both rotatably connected with front wheels 702 through pin shafts, a stirring device is arranged in the water storage tank 2, a spraying angle adjusting device is arranged on the base 1, a water inlet 4 is arranged at the top of the water storage tank 2, a filter basket net 5 is welded on the inner wall of the top of the water storage tank 2, a basket net opening of the filter basket net 5, the water outlet pipe 12 is communicated with the water storage tank 2.
Agitating unit includes worm wheel 10, and the central point of 2 bottom tank walls of storage water tank puts and is connected with a pivot 9 through the bearing rotation, and the lower extreme of pivot 9 runs through the bottom tank wall and the base 1 and the worm wheel 10 coaxial bonding of storage water tank 2, worm wheel 10 and 8 intermeshing of worm, and the pivot 9 is located the partial welding of 2 inside of storage water tank and has a plurality of stirring blade 11.
The spraying angle adjustable device comprises a water pump 13 and a water pump 13, wherein a vertical fixing plate 14 is welded at one end of the base 1 far away from the push handle 3, the water pump 13 is arranged on the base 1, and is located between storage water tank 2 and fixed plate 14, the upper end welding of fixed plate 14 has a rotation seat 15, rotate seat 15 and connect with an adjusting plate 16 through rotating, the water inlet of water pump 13 is connected with discharging tube 12 and communicated with, the delivery port of water pump 13 connects with a aqueduct 17, the end that aqueduct 17 keeps away from water pump 13 is connected with a shower nozzle 18, the part body that aqueduct 17 is close to shower nozzle 18 is fixed on adjusting plate 16, rotate the connection through the damping pivot between seat 15 and the adjusting plate 16, the damping pivot is the pivot structure (for example the pivot of the notebook computer) that can stop in arbitrary angle, the model of water pump 13 is WQ 100-10-3.
The utility model discloses in, push away the device to river or lake side, take out the natural water resource in the river and make storage water tank 2 interior storage, wherein the filtration basket net 5 of water inlet 4 department can filter out impurity such as silt pasture and water of aquatic, when irrigating, at first open water pump 13, water in the storage water tank 2 is through aqueduct 12, water pump 13 and aqueduct 17, irrigate the plant in gardens from 18 blowout of shower nozzle, in the irrigation process, can change 18 angles of shower nozzle through rotating regulating plate 16, thereby carry out effectual irrigation to the plant of far and near.
When needs fertilize and spout the medicine to landscape plant, can be with fertilizer water or pesticide from adding in storage water tank 2, when promoting irrigation equipment to remove, the worm 8 that rear wheel 701 and ground friction roll made takes place to rotate, drive worm wheel 10 through the transmission and produce the rotation with pivot 9 and stirring vane 11 together, and stirring vane 11 carries out the intensive mixing with fertilizer water or pesticide with storage water tank 2 water-logging, spray the plant from shower nozzle 18, also play the effect of fertilizeing and spouting the medicine in the irrigation.
